What companies run services between Bonn, Germany and Portugal?

Eurowings, Ryanair, and Swiss fly from Cologne Bonn Airport (CGN) to Francisco De Sá Carneiro Airport (OPO) 3 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bonn UN Campus to R. Palma via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ine), Estação Rodoviária de Lisboa Oriente, and Estação Oriente in around 33h 50m.
